When and how should I follow up?

Had coffee with an alumni who works at a regional BB about 5-6 weeks ago, and we had a good connection. He told me to keep in touch especially since they are looking for another analyst during FT recruiting. Its nearing the end of summer and I am wondering when I should circle back and speak to him again. Should I offer to get coffee again? Should I just let him know I'm still interested in the position? My school has an OCR program with this BB but there aren't any postings on the website and nothing has really started up yet. How can I stay at the top of his mind without being annoying?

Simply ask him how he's doing. Perhaps if you know the product, perhaps add your thoughts on it. Additionally, end the e-mail with 'would you like to get coffee at the next available point?'

That hardly sounds annoying.

anamerican
 

Agree. Also, don't forget to say "I've followed your advice to blah blah and blah~~"in your email if he ever offered advice to you.

Plus, if you haven't done so, add him on LinkedIn.
